Our Striping and Pavement Marking Process

A long lasting striping job depends on preparation and sequencing, not just a quick coat of white or yellow paint. Precision Asphalt Rochester follows a step-by-step process that is tailored to Rochester, NY conditions.

First, we clean the surface. We use mechanical blowers, brooms, and when needed pressure washing to remove salt residue, sand from winter plowing, loose aggregate, and oil soaked debris. If we skip this step, your new lines will peel in the first season, so we spend the time to get the pavement as clean and dry as the weather allows.

Second, we assess and repair problem areas that will immediately ruin new striping. This might include filling deep cracks that cut through parking stalls, patching potholes in drive lanes, or grinding down high spots that collect standing water. We do not paint straight over these issues, because new markings over failing asphalt simply do not hold.

Third, we layout and measure. Using chalk lines, tape, and professional measuring wheels, our crew marks stall widths, aisle widths, and turning radiuses. Rochester and Monroe County fire codes typically require a minimum clear fire lane width, usually 20 feet, and we check that your configuration leaves those access routes open and properly labeled. For ADA accessible spaces, we confirm dimensions for van accessible stalls, loading zones, and approach routes so you stay compliant with New York State and federal standards.

Finally, we stripe using professional airless line stripers that deliver consistent pressure and line width. We match line thickness and color to your use case: 4 inch lines for regular stalls, 6 inch or 8 inch for fire lanes and stop bars, and high contrast colors for crosswalks. Once painting is complete, we post or provide recommended closure times, typically 1 to 2 hours for light traffic in warm weather and longer if it is cool or humid.

Design Options: Layouts, Colors, and Specialty Markings

Striping is more than just white lines. A smart layout can improve traffic flow, reduce fender benders, and even fit more cars without violating code. Precision Asphalt Rochester works with you to redesign or tweak your lot when needed, especially if the current layout causes backups on busy Rochester roads like West Henrietta Road or Ridge Road.

We can convert narrow two-way lanes into one-way with angled parking where appropriate, add dedicated pick-up zones for restaurants and retail, and stripe wider end caps to protect landscaping from winter plow damage. For multi-tenant plazas, we help separate customer parking from employee parking with color coding or labeled stalls.

Color is another tool. Standard practice in our area is white for general stalls and yellow for curbs and hazard zones. Fire lanes are typically marked with bold lettering and red or yellow curb striping, depending on local preferences and any specific fire marshal requests. For industrial facilities, we often add interior yard markings such as pedestrian walkways in bright white, forklift routes in yellow, and hatch zones where loading dock access must stay clear.

Specialty markings include ADA symbols, directional arrows, word legends like STOP, ONLY, VISITOR, speed bumps, and crosswalks. We use durable stencils sized to current standards, not improvised templates that can cause clarity or compliance problems. If your property has HOA oversight or franchise brand standards, we can match specified layouts and colors and coordinate with property managers to ensure the final striping passes their review the first time.

What Affects Cost and Scheduling for Asphalt Striping

Homeowners, property managers, and business owners in Rochester often ask why striping quotes can vary. At Precision Asphalt Rochester, we are upfront about what drives the cost of asphalt striping and pavement markings so there are no surprises.

The main factors are total linear footage of striping, the number and complexity of stenciled markings, surface condition, and how much layout work is needed. A simple reseal of an existing lot with clear, accurate lines that we can trace is more affordable than a complete reconfiguration that requires new measurements, traffic flow changes, and additional markings like crosswalks and signage.

Surface condition matters. If the asphalt is heavily cracked, oxidized, or contaminated with oil, more preparation is required. Sometimes we recommend crack filling and sealcoating before re-striping so that your markings will last. It can feel like an extra step, but repainting on failing pavement is usually wasted money in our climate. Rochester freeze-thaw cycles can break apart weak pavement in a single winter.

Scheduling in our region is also a real factor. Outdoor striping needs dry pavement and reasonable temperatures. We watch local forecasts closely. In spring and fall, we often group nearby projects in Rochester, Greece, Irondequoit, and Henrietta so we can move quickly when weather windows open. For 24-hour operations like medical facilities, hotels, and distribution centers, we can phase work, closing and reopening sections of the lot so your business stays accessible while we stripe.

We provide written estimates that break out line striping, stenciling, and any prep or minor asphalt repair, so you can see where your dollars go and decide what to prioritize this season versus next.

What Rochester Property Owners Should Check Before Hiring

Before you choose a contractor for asphalt striping in the Rochester, NY area, there are a few practical checks that protect you and your property. Precision Asphalt Rochester encourages you to ask these questions of anyone you are considering, including us.

First, confirm that the company is familiar with Rochester and Monroe County requirements. Accessible parking rules, fire lane markings, and reserved space signage all have specific size and placement guidelines. While most small projects do not require a separate city permit just to re-stripe, incorrect markings can cause headaches during fire inspections, insurance reviews, or property sales. Ask for examples of lots they have completed locally and, if you manage multi-family or commercial property, verify that their work has passed inspection.

Second, make sure they carry proper liability and workers compensation insurance and are willing to provide proof. Striping crews work around parked cars and pedestrian areas, and accidents, although rare, can happen. You want coverage in place before any paint hits the pavement.

Third, review their plan for traffic control and communication. Good striping work temporarily restricts access. A professional contractor will give you a clear schedule, maps or diagrams if needed, and simple instructions you can pass on to tenants, employees, or customers. For busy Rochester sites, we usually recommend off-peak or overnight work and will coordinate with your towing or security vendors if you use them.

Lastly, ask about the materials they will use, expected lifespan in our climate, and any warranty. At Precision Asphalt Rochester, we explain how long you can realistically expect your striping to stay bright under typical Rochester snow, plowing, and salt use, and we stand behind the workmanship so you know who to call if something does not look right after the first season.
